                But of course...
                
                A whole two albums, both on Capitol records.
                
                ICON - Icon (c) 1984 produced by Mike Varney
                
                (Rock On) Through the Night
                Killer Machine
                On Your Feet
                World War
                Hot Desert Night
                Under My Gun
                Iconoclast
                Rock 'N' Roll Maniac
                I'm Alive
                It's Up to You
                
                ICON - Night of the Crime (c) 1985 produced by 
                       Eddie Kramer  (where  do  I know that name
                       from???)
                
                Naked Eyes
                Missing
                Danger Calling
                Shot At My Heart
                Out for Blood
                Raise the Hammer
                Frozen Tears
                The Whites of their Eyes
                Hungry for Love
                Rock my Radio

    The new album is called Right between the Eyes, I just got it 
    (along with a coupla others).
    
    Side A				Side B
    
    Right between the eyes		Holy man's water
    Two for the road			Bad times
    Taking my breath away		Double life
    A far cry/A.Y.U.			Forever young
    In your eyes			Running under fire
    					Peace and love
    
    Vocals:	Jerry Harrison
    Guitar:	Dan Wexler
    Bass:	Tracy Wallach
    Drums:	Pat Dixon
    Guitar:	Drew Bollmann

                Well, went  to  Icon  last  night (thanks for the
                tix, Paul).  There were probably about 100 people
                there, which is fine  with  me  as I hate crowded
                clubs.  As far as  performance  goes,  they  were
                excellent, but they played too much new stuff for
                my tastes.  Their mix was also  terrible.   Drums
                sound  was a lot louder than the bass  which  was
                louder than  everything  else.    The  vocals and
                guitars were very  muddy sounding.  As far as old
                tunes, they played three:    Under My Gun, Whites
                of Their Eyes and Out  For Blood.  The new guitar
                team  is not as good.   Before,  it  was  like  a
                guitar duet along the lines of Iron  Maiden,  now
                it's just two guitarists.  The new guitarist  was
                a cool guy.  I played a game of  chess  with  him
                before  they went on.  He had a portable computer
                with him  and was out in the lobby playing chess.
                The new singer I can live without.  He has one of
                those raspy sounding voices (ala Rough Cutt) that
                I really don't like.   After the show, some idiot
                came up to him and said, "I hope you aren't going
                to say you took voice lessons." The  guy admitted
                he never has (big deal).  I asked  the  kid, "Who
                are you, Tony Harnell?" The old singer left as he
                went 'born-again'.  The old guitarist got married
                and got out of  the  whole  music scene.  Overall
                though, a good show.
